Table 1
Overview of investigated audio conditions. For plausible binaural auralizations detailed information on used binaural room impulse resonse (BRIR) sets, used head-related impulse response (HRIR) set and headphone equalization (HPEQ), spatial resolution, and frequency independent direct-to-reverberant energy ratio (DRRs) in dB of BRIRs are given.
